Table 6. NI 5421/5441 AWG Module Front Panel LEDs
LED Indications
ACCESS Indicates the basic hardware status of the NI 5421/5441 AWG module.
This LED functions identically to the ACCESS LED on the
NI 5610 upconverter module front panel.
OFF—The module is not yet functional or has detected a problem with a power
rail.
AMBER—The module is being accessed.
GREEN—The module is ready to be programmed.
ACTIVE Indicates the state of the NI 5421/544 1 AWG module.
OFF—The module is not armed or triggered.
AMBER—The module is armed and waiting for a Start trigger.
GREEN—The module has received a Start trigger and is generating awaveform.
RED—The module has detected an error state; this may indicate PLL unlocking,
self-test failure, or calibration failure.
